British Geological Survey data on unconfined compressive strength tests for salt samples from the Northwich Halite Member at Winsford Mine, Cheshire, UK. Each sample was deformed under uniaxial stress conditions at controlled strain or loading rates in a servo-controlled load frame. The data are separated into individual Excel files containing time, force, stress, displacement, and strain measurements.

Strengths
- Data originates from the British Geological Survey's Rock Mechanics and Physics Laboratory, an authoritative source.
- Tests were conducted under controlled conditions with specified strain (1e-5 per second) or loading (200 N/s) rates.
- Each test file contains multiple measurement types: time, force, stress, displacement, and strain.
